Problem with Backup status and Configeration

My home network has an attached Linkstation which I want to use for running
weekly backups. When the Backup status and Config wizard runs it finds the
Linkstation as well as the folder where I want to place the backup (
Linkstation\Archive\Vista Backup ) however when I select the folder and
click next I am asked for user name and password to access the Linkstation
which doesn't require a users name or password to access from my pc. If I
enter the name of my pc and my user name ( vista 1\myaccount name) and my pc
account password and click next I receive the following message " No mapping
between the account names and security ID was done 0x80070534)

I also have one of the folders in the linkstation mapped as Z drive which
Backup doesn't see.

Any suggestions?
